The Challenges of Midlife Professional Life

  • Sedentary work: Long hours at a desk reduce movement and posture

  • Stress: Increases cortisol, promoting fat storage and reducing recovery

  • Time constraints: Less time for gym sessions and meal prep

  • Travel & irregular schedules: Disrupts sleep, training, and nutrition

Without a strategic plan, fitness and health often take a back seat — but the right programme changes that.

Key Principles for Executive Fitness Over 40

1. Short, High-Impact Workouts

Time-efficient strength and conditioning sessions (20–40 minutes) can:

  • Maintain or build muscle

  • Improve cardiovascular health

  • Boost energy and metabolism

Circuit training, functional movements, and resistance exercises deliver maximum results in minimal time.

2. Mobility and Posture Work

Quick daily routines prevent stiffness, improve posture, and reduce office-related aches. Focus on:

  • Hip openers

  • Shoulder stretches

  • Spinal mobility

3. Smart Nutrition for Busy Schedules

Nutrition doesn’t need to be complicated. Principles include:

  • Protein-focused meals for muscle maintenance

  • Balanced carbs for energy during long workdays

  • Healthy fats for hormone support

  • Meal prep and planning for convenience

4. Recovery and Stress Management

Even a 10-minute mindfulness, stretching, or walk routine improves recovery, reduces cortisol, and supports fat loss.
